package system
import "github.com/docker/docker/api/client/system"
Index ¶
- func DecodeEvents(input io.Reader, ep eventProcessor) error
- func NewEventsCommand(dockerCli *client.DockerCli) *cobra.Command
- func NewVersionCommand(dockerCli *client.DockerCli) *cobra.Command
- type EventHandler
Functions ¶
func DecodeEvents ¶
DecodeEvents decodes event from input stream
func NewEventsCommand ¶
NewEventsCommand creats a new cobra.Command for `docker events`
func NewVersionCommand ¶
NewVersionCommand creats a new cobra.Command for `docker version`
Types ¶
type EventHandler ¶
type EventHandler interface { Handle(action string, h func(eventtypes.Message)) Watch(c <-chan eventtypes.Message) }
EventHandler is abstract interface for user to customize own handle functions of each type of events
func InitEventHandler ¶
func InitEventHandler() EventHandler
InitEventHandler initializes and returns an EventHandler
Source Files ¶
events.go events_utils.go version.go
- Version
- v1.12.0
- Published
- Jul 28, 2016
- Platform
- js/wasm
- Imports
- 20 packages
- Last checked
- 1 minute ago –
Tools for package owners.